关于SPSite对象创建时报错.

   环境:Sql server 2008 R2 ,sharepoint 2010 VS2010   windows server 2008 R2   控制台应用程序

代码:using (SPSite site = new SPSite("http://sh-fm-dhc/"))
            {}

创建SPSite 对象时出现:找不到位于"http://sh-fm-dhc/" 的 Web 应用程序。请确认正确键入了此 URL。如果此 URL 需要提供现有内容,则系统管理员可能需要添加到指定应用程序的新请求 URL 映射

这个我在网上也找了很久,最后发现生成这个地方,调试平台是X86的,改成X64平台就可以了.修改方法:生成 - 配置管理器  ,下面就是你的项目, 平台,新建 X64 ,保存就OK了

using (SPSite site = new SPSite("http://sh-fm-dhc/"))
            {
posted @ 2011-06-13 11:41  Jack_F  阅读(197)  评论(0)    收藏  举报